In this lesson, you will review how to complete a data upload for the TXPRO app.
Only the school districts in Texas will use the TXPRO application.
Only District users with appropriate permissions are able to complete the following task.
Before You Get Started
The TXPRO accountability projections uses STAAR and TELPAS assessment files to project accountability scores of districts and campuses. The files submitted by the user will be processed and if the student assessment data is relevant to the accountability year for which it was uploaded, the data will be stored and used in the accountability projections. You will need the following assessment files:
- STAAR, and/or
- TELPAS data files, in .dat and .txt formats that you received from the state
At this time, CAF or Consolidated Accountability File, based accountability projections are not supported.
Data Upload
- Select Data Upload.
- Click-Drag-Drop appropriate files from your device into the screen, or select Upload Files.
- A Last Calculated message is available to show the date, time, and number of students when data was last calculated
Keep in mind, any changes made may recalculate or change accountability projections for the entire school district. You may close or dismiss this message.
- Files selected will continue to upload, showing Progress Bars for each file being uploaded.
- If you wish to stop the upload process, select Cancel.
- When files are complete, the files will appear with Thumbnails icons.
- Select Submit to confirm uploaded files.

- Select Cancel to stop the process and return to the File Upload page.
- To continue, select Submit.
